Çözüldü vba Türkçe harfleri tanımlama hk.

  • Konuyu başlatan Konuyu başlatan ezelk
  • Başlangıç tarihi Başlangıç tarihi

ezelk

Forum Yöneticisi
Yönetici
Excel Versiyonu
Excel 2016
Excel Sürümü
64 Bit
Excel Dili
Türkçe
Merhaba , ekte internette bulduğum bir kod var. Konu hakkında bilgim olmadığı için çok az bir değişiklik yapabildim. Hücre içindeki metinden büyük / küçük harfleri ayrıştırıyor. Bu kodun Türkçe karakterleri de tanıması için ne yapmam gerekir ? bu haliyle tanımıyor ve hatalı işlem yapıyor.

Kod:
Görüntülemek için giriş yapmanız gerekmektedir.
(9 satır)
 
Şöyle deneyin.

Asc... kısımlarının herbiri Türkçe karakterlere ilişkin kısımlardır.

CSS:
Görüntülemek için giriş yapmanız gerekmektedir.
(12 satır)

.
 
Merhaba Ömer bey ,
öncelikle hızlı yanıt için teşekkürler. kod bende tam olarak çalışmadı. gönderdiğiniz koda baktım 208-221-240-253 başka karakterlere denk geliyor gibi. asc leri aşağıdaki gibi değiştirdim oldu, ya da umarım oldu.

CSS:
Görüntülemek için giriş yapmanız gerekmektedir.
(12 satır)
]
 
Şöyle eksiksiz oluyor (denedim)

Kırmızı kısımları isterseniz silebilirsiniz.

VBA:
Görüntülemek için giriş yapmanız gerekmektedir.
(13 satır)

.
 
Moderatörün son düzenlenenleri:
Sayfayı yenileyerek bir önceki cevabımı tekrar kontrol edin.
Hücredeki son karakterin istenmeyen karakter olma durumunun kontrolü gerekiyordu.
Onu ilişkin kontrol ekledim.

.
 
A1'e abcçdefgğhıijklmnoöprsştuüvyzqwxABCÇDEFGĞHIİJKLMNOÖPRSŞTUÜVYZQWX yazın ve B1'e =harf(A1) formülünü uygulayın.
Sonra da başka bir hücreye =A1=B1 formülünü uygulayınca sonucun DOĞRU olması gerekir.
 
Üst